Not sure what the problem was, but, I know that I use cement on the thread wraps before putting any foam on a hook. This makes the fly more durable plus keeps the foam from turning on the hook. Also, keep in mind that store bought flies usually have no cement used on them anywhere. I use a lot of foam in my tying and I concur on the advice given. I also find that using heavier thread like 3/0 Monocord and lighter pressure helps reduce the thread cutting problem.
